  14. Quentin Tarantino’s Top 50 Favorite Sequels 's icon

    Quentin Tarantino’s Top 50 Favorite Sequels

    Favs/dislikes: 4:0. As listed in Video Watchdog issue no. 72. Per his personal rules, these are only sequels so anything other than a part II does not count (hence the absence of The Good, The Bad and the Ugly). Some rules are bent: for example Frankenstein Meets the Wolf Man is the fifth film in the Frankenstein series, but the second in the Wolf Man series
